Articles of комментарии

wp_trash_post retrashes уже разгромили комментарии?

У меня есть несколько функций mail- и update_user_meta, которые срабатывают, когда комментарий, комментарий или комментарий для пользователя получает tharshhed. Поэтому, когда я удаляю комментарий с помощью trash_comment, письмо отправляется автору: «Эй, ваш комментарий получил оборван». Прохладный, он работает хорошо. Но … Когда я разгромил связанный пост … Автор уже избитого комментария снова получает ту же […]

transition_comment_status вызывается при неподходящих комментариях

Кажется, я не могу понять, почему не пропустить комментарий, называет мой «approve_comment_callback» -action. Есть идеи? Я просто не хочу, чтобы он отправлял два письма одновременно, когда я не просматривал комментарий. Вот две (почтовые) функции, которые, похоже, сталкиваются … // Send mail to user when their comment has been restored function untrash_answer_notification($comment_id) { $comment = get_comment($comment_id); […]

Показать DISQUS на главной странице

Я установил disqus, и я хочу, чтобы он появился на моей домашней странице. Он заменил старую систему комментариев WordPress на страницах и сообщениях, но я также хочу, чтобы она появилась на index.php мой файл index.php сейчас -> http://img.wordpressask.com/comments/TxaroMC.png Я добавил < ?php comments_template(); ?> ?php comments_template(); ?> но ничего не случилось. Что мне делать ? […]

Как заставить пользователей вставлять свои комментарии

Я пытаюсь понять, как заставить комментаторов использовать комментарии с несколькими потоками (а не общие поля комментариев в нижней части сообщения) на одном конкретном посту. Я хочу, чтобы администраторы могли публиковать новые комментарии верхнего уровня и заставить всех других пользователей нажать кнопку «Ответить» в комментарии, на который они отвечают. Я попытался использовать CSS, чтобы скрыть окно […]

Добавить комментарий meta

Мне нужно добавить свою обычную мета в новые комментарии. Вот что я сделал: /************************************************************************/ /* Add meta to comments /************************************************************************/ // Save field add_action ('comment_post', 'add_meta_settings', 1); function add_meta_settings($comment_id) { add_comment_meta($comment_id, 'comment_section', $_POST['comment_section'], true); } Эта работа, когда я создаю новый комментарий. Но если я опубликую комментарий, используя ссылку «Ответить» (другому комментарию), мета не сохраняется […]

Третья сторона Вход в wordpress

У меня есть два сайта. Один на wordpress и один сайт без WordPress. Теперь я использовал верхний и нижний колонтитулы на моем сайте, отличном от WordPress. Я хочу, чтобы, если пользователь входит в систему на моем сайте, отличном от WordPress, он может использовать тот же адрес электронной почты и имя для комментариев на моем сайте […]

Пользовательские вложенные комментарии в WordPress с аватаром

Я разрабатываю тему и не знаю, как WordPress обрабатывает выходные комментарии. У меня есть wp_list_comments в моих комментариях.php, но я не уверен, как настроить вывод, чтобы получить желаемый результат, как в прилагаемом изображении. Любые предложения по настройке вывода, отображаемого wp_list_comments ?

Есть ли лучший способ проверить новый комментарий?

У меня есть код, который работает на клиенте, который проверяет каждые 30 секунд или около того для новых комментариев, и если новый комментарий обнаружен, пользователь получает предупреждение. Проверка подсчитывает комментарии на странице и возвращает счет. Код для проверки комментариев: check_for_new_comments() { $sitewide = get_option( 'sitewide_mode', 0 ); $postID = $_POST['postID']; $postID = ( $sitewide ) […]

URL-адрес страницы пользователя нарушен

Мой домен – http://mongage.com. Я не знаю, что случилось с моим сайтом. URL-адрес пользователя, связанный с авторской / пользовательской страницей, нарушен. Я переключился на новую тему, но не успел. Я использую thenthteenнадцать и следующий код: <a href="<?php echo esc_url( get_author_posts_url( get_the_author_meta( 'ID' ) ) ); ?>" rel="author"> в моих functions.php, я переписываю URL страницы пользователя […]

Комментарии Disqus появляются только на новом посте

Я установил комментарии Disqus в нашем блоге компании ( ссылка ) Создав файл comments.php, выполните следующие действия: <div id="disqus_thread" style="margin-top:50px;position:relative;"></div> <script type="text/javascript"> var disqus_shortname = 'thebouqs'; (function() { var dsq = document.createElement('script'); dsq.type = 'text/javascript'; dsq.async = true; dsq.src = '//' + disqus_shortname + '.disqus.com/embed.js'; (document.getElementsByTagName('head')[0] || document.getElementsByTagName('body')[0]).appendChild(dsq); })(); </script> и в файле single.php get_template_part( […]